UNIMI.CropML_NL is a software component implementing approaches to the modellization of nitrogen limited crop development and growth. Models are implemented using a fine granularity, and they are also used in composite structures which can used as simulation models in applications.
This component is an extension of UNIMI.CropML_WL component, that is publicly available inclusive of Software Development Kit, help file and code documentation file.
For this reason, this help file does not include any documentation of the approaches implemented in CropML_WL for modelling potential crop development and growth, but it contains a full description of the algorithms used only for water limitations.
Being an extension, the CropML_NL has a dependency to the UNIMI.CropML.dll, UNIMI.CropML_WL.dll, to the UNIMI.CropML.Interfaces.dll and UNIMI.CropML_WL.Interfaces.dll. For using in custom applications, the user must handle these four libraries.

CropML_NL-WOFOST .(Van Keulen and Wolf, 1986; Boogaard et al.,1998) is a member of the family of crop growth models developed in Wageningen by the school of C.T. de Wit. It follows the hierarchical distinction between potential and limited production and share similar crop growth submodels, with light interception and CO2 assimilation as growth driving processes and crop phenological development as growth controlling process.
